Georges Kern: The Architect of Breitling's Resurgence
Georges Kern's appointment as CEO of Breitling in 2017 was met with a mixture of anticipation and skepticism. The brand, while possessing a rich history and a strong reputation for aviation-inspired timepieces, had lost some of its luster in the preceding years. Kern, however, brought a fresh perspective and a clear vision. His experience at IWC Schaffhausen, where he successfully revitalized the brand, proved invaluable in guiding Breitling's transformation.
His strategy was multi-pronged. First, he streamlined the product portfolio, focusing on core collections and eliminating redundant models. This helped to clarify Breitling's brand identity and avoid diluting its message. Second, he embraced a more modern and inclusive marketing approach, shifting away from a traditionally conservative image and appealing to a broader, younger demographic. This involved collaborations with influencers, celebrities, and sporting events, significantly increasing Breitling's visibility and reach.
Third, Kern emphasized quality and craftsmanship, ensuring that Breitling maintained its reputation for producing robust and reliable timepieces. This commitment to quality extended to the brand's retail strategy, with a focus on enhancing the customer experience both online and in physical boutiques. The results speak for themselves. Breitling's impressive ascent into the top ten Swiss watch brands by sales last year, with annual sales figures that remain undisclosed but are undoubtedly significant, stands as a testament to Kern’s leadership and strategic vision.

Breitling Watch Investment: A Growing Asset Class
Breitling watches, particularly vintage and limited-edition models, have become increasingly sought after by collectors and investors. The brand's resurgence under Kern has further fueled this trend, making Breitling watches a potentially lucrative investment. The appreciation of certain Breitling models in the secondary market mirrors the broader growth of the luxury watch investment market. However, it's crucial to remember that any investment carries risk, and the value of a watch can fluctuate depending on various factors, including market demand, condition, and rarity. Therefore, thorough research and due diligence are essential for anyone considering investing in Breitling watches or any luxury timepiece.
